The oil is rich in high quality antioxidants, which neutralize free radicals that can be harmful to the skin. Yet a batch of olive oil soap can take up to a month to produce. Shortly afterward, casts are laid down to cut the soap into individual blocks, which are then stamped with the traditional seal of the factory of production.
